There are various factors that may cause an instrument to fail. The most common involve broken parts of the guitar. Prolonged use of instruments, falls, shock and cracks are the cause for most failures. They cause damage to parts such as the neck pots, potentiometers, neck and head joint, nuts and machine heads. Correction of this problem needs a thorough assessment to detect even hidden problems. All parts are then repaired or replaced.

At times repairing may not be necessitated by broken parts. Rather, it occurs when the instrument produces poor quality. This is due to improper fixing of the vital parts. This can occur during a purchase or when there is poor storage. These parts may become loose with time and thus prompt a replacement. A technician will work to ensure that the instrument produces quality sound and a rich tone. They adjust string heights and the neck shape. Proper setting of the octave will allow for a better frequency and accuracy of tone.
